Field Sales Engineer Jobs in California: Frequently Asked Questions
How do you become a field sales engineer in California?
The standard path into field sales engineering in California starts with a bachelor's degree in electrical engineering, mechanical engineering, or a closely related discipline, since California employers consistently use it as a baseline requirement. No state-issued license is required for the role itself. Most candidates build credibility through two to four years in a technical support, applications engineering, or inside sales role at a California manufacturer or technology company before moving into a field-facing position.
How much do field sales engineers make in California?
Field sales engineers in California earn a median of about $139,160 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$78,850 for the lowest 10% to over $213,370 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

Which California cities have the most field sales engineer jobs?
San Jose, Fremont, and San Diego account for the largest share of field sales engineer openings in California. The Bay Area dominates because of its dense cluster of semiconductor, cloud hardware, and life sciences companies, while San Diego's strength in wireless technology and biomedical devices drives significant demand there, and Los Angeles anchors aerospace and industrial automation hiring in the south.
Are there remote field sales engineer jobs in California?
Yes, but they're limited. Field sales engineering is inherently a territory-based, customer-facing role that requires on-site product demonstrations, equipment installations, and in-person relationship management, so fully remote positions are uncommon. About 23% of field sales engineer openings tied to California are remote or hybrid as of June 2026. Where flexibility does exist, it tends to apply to pre-sales consulting and technical scoping calls rather than the hands-on field work.
How can I get hired as a field sales engineer in California with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ry point is an applications engineer or technical sales support role at a California-based manufacturer or distributor, where you learn the product line and customer base before moving into a field quota-carrying position. Large California employers in semiconductor equipment and medical devices regularly bring on new graduates as sales development engineers or associate field application engineers. Earning a Certified Sales Professional designation or completing a manufacturer's sales certification gives candidates a measurable edge.
